Environmental Performance of The Connector

Common environmental performance contains heat resistance, moisture resistance, salt fog resistance, vibration and shock, etc. Although these trials is in the form of the whole connector, but most of the test is still on the surface of the plating. When the surface plating can’t bear high heat, wet and salt spray test, product is disqualification.

How to Define the Electronic Connector Terminals

Electronic connector terminals is a metal product, which is made of copper alloy processed by high-speed continuous stamping die. Terminals is the most crucial parts in the connectors to guarantee the electronic contact. The terminals is made up with two parts, The male and the female contact. What is Progressive Die Stamping?

Progressive stamping is a precision metal process used to make parts for various fields, such as automotive, medical, electronics, and appliances. The Advantages of Cold Metal Stamping Parts

Stamping parts with light weight, thin thickness, good rigidity. The dimension tolerance is guaranteed by the mold, so the quality is stable.It can generally be used without mechanical cutting.
